Ingredients

For the Roasted Butternut Squash

  • 1 small butternut squash, peeled and diced (about 3 cups)
  • 2 tbsp olive oil
  • Salt and black pepper, to taste

For the Creamy Orzo

  • 1½ cups orzo pasta
  • 3 cups vegetable broth (or water)
  • 2 tbsp butter
  • 2 cloves garlic, minced

For the Finishing Touches

  • ½ cup grated Parmesan cheese
  • ¼ cup heavy cream
  • 2 cups baby spinach, roughly chopped
  • ½ tsp dried thyme (optional)
  • Pinch of red pepper flakes (optional)
  • 2 tablespoons fresh parsley, finely chopped (for garnish)

How to Make Creamy Orzo with Roasted Butternut Squash and Spinach

Step 1: Preheat the Oven

Preheat your oven to 400°F (200°C).

Step 2: Roast the Squash

  • Toss the diced butternut squash with olive oil, salt, and black pepper.
  • Spread the seasoned squash evenly on a baking sheet.
  • Roast in the oven for 25–30 minutes until tender.

Step 3: Prepare the Orzo

In a large saucepan over medium heat:
Melt the butter.
Add minced garlic and sauté for about one minute until fragrant.
Stir in orzo pasta and toast lightly for around two minutes.

Step 4: Cook the Orzo

Pour in vegetable broth:
Bring to a simmer.
Cook for about 10–12 minutes until orzo is tender.

Step 5: Combine Ingredients

Once the orzo is cooked:
Stir in grated Parmesan cheese and heavy cream.
Add chopped spinach and cook until wilted.

Step 6: Finish Up

Gently fold in the roasted butternut squash:
Adjust seasoning to taste before serving warm.

Common Mistakes to Avoid

When making Creamy Orzo with Roasted Butternut Squash and Spinach, it’s easy to overlook some key details. Here are common mistakes to avoid.

  • Overcooking the squash: This can lead to a mushy texture. Roast until tender but not falling apart—about 25–30 minutes at 400°F.
  • Skipping the toasting step: Not toasting the orzo can result in less flavor. Lightly toast for about 2 minutes before adding broth for a nuttier taste.
  • Using too much liquid: Excess liquid can make the dish soupy. Stick to the recommended broth amount and adjust as needed.
  • Neglecting seasoning adjustments: Taste your dish before serving. Adjust salt, pepper, and even add red pepper flakes for a kick if desired.
  • Not letting the spinach wilt properly: Undercooked spinach might be tough. Ensure you cook it just until wilted for optimal flavor and texture.

Refrigerator Storage

  • Store in an airtight container.
  • Keep for up to 3 days in the refrigerator.
  • Let it cool completely before sealing.

Freezing Creamy Orzo with Roasted Butternut Squash and Spinach

  • Use freezer-safe containers or bags.
  • It can be frozen for up to 2 months.
  • Label containers with date and contents.

Reheating Creamy Orzo with Roasted Butternut Squash and Spinach

  • Oven: Preheat to 350°F (175°C) and bake covered for about 20 minutes until heated through.
  • Microwave: Heat in short intervals of 1-2 minutes, stirring in between until warmed evenly.
  • Stovetop: Warm over medium heat in a skillet with a splash of broth or water, stirring frequently.

Can I make this dish vegan?

Yes! Substitute plant-based butter for regular butter and use nutritional yeast instead of Parmesan cheese for a delicious vegan version.
